Subject: Quiet room, 6th floor

Hello all,

Visiting contractors working at Bramwick House may use the quiet room on the top floor for focused work or calls. It seats four and cannot be booked; first come, first served. Please keep equipment clear of the fire exit. The door lock was rekeyed this week, so use the code below.

staff pass of kawip-hawef = bdg-QLP-2

Subject: Key rotation for InvoiceForge renderer

Welcome, new folks. Every quarter we rotate the credential the Pellworth PDF invoice renderer uses to call our internal asset service, Vaultline. The old key stops working Friday at noon. Update your local .env and the staging config before then, and verify a test invoice renders with the new embedded fonts. For convenience, the freshly issued key is included here.

app token of bagef-bageg = kto11_vuwA0uhrEMg

## Authentication

The Dunmere resolver sidecar occasionally returns stale records during failover, which caused intermittent auth handshake failures in earlier releases. As a mitigation, the client now pins resolved addresses for 30 seconds and retries once on NXDOMAIN. Reviewers should verify that pinned entries are never cached beyond TTL. To exercise the auth path against the review environment, present this credential.

session JWT of yawep-yawep = eyJhbGciOiJIUzI1NiIsInR5cCI6IkpXVCJ9.eyJzdWIiOiI3pWF3_In0.aXYsHiog